From the discussion above, a dysfunction of epiglottic inversion may be due to direct trauma to the fibroelastic body (Kawana, et al., 98), prolonged presence of a tube displacing the epiglottis, or some destructive disease process (i.e., chondromalacia , tumor formation, atriovenous malformation, etc.) that ...

The relationship between vallecular residue and oral-stage dysphagia, reduced hyoid elevation, and movement of the epiglottis was assessed in 330 patients referred to the speech pathology section for evaluation of oropharyngeal …
